Requesting A VA Disability Claim Predetermination Hearing On Your Supplemental Claim
When your initial claim is denied or you disagree with the decision, you have options to appeal or submit a supplemental claim. One important step in this process is requesting a predetermination hearing on your supplemental claim. This hearing can give you a chance to present new evidence and explain your case before the VA makes a final decision.

What to Expect During a BVA Hearing
Navigating the VA disability claims process can be challenging. When your claim is denied or you disagree with a VA decision, you might find yourself preparing for a Board of Veterans’ Appeals (BVA) hearing. Knowing what to expect during this hearing can help you feel more confident and ready to present your case effectively.

VA Disability Claim Personal Statement Samples and Examples for Veterans
One vital part of a successful VA claim is the personal statement. This document allows veterans to share their experiences, explain their conditions, and provide context that may not be evident from medical records.
